bristly

US /ˈbrɪs.li/
UK /ˈbrɪs.li/
"bristly" picture
1.

erizado, espinoso

covered with or as if with bristles; stiff and prickly

:
The old man had a short, bristly beard.
El anciano tenía una barba corta y erizada.
The dog's fur was thick and bristly.
El pelaje del perro era grueso y erizado.
2.

irritable, áspero

easily offended or annoyed; irritable

:
He was in a bristly mood after the long meeting.
Estaba de un humor irritable después de la larga reunión.
Her tone was rather bristly when she responded.
Su tono fue bastante áspero cuando respondió.
